- DictionarySen·ior mo·ment/ˈsēnyər ˈmōmənt/
noun
- 1. a temporary mental lapse (humorously attributed to the gradual loss of one's mental faculties as one grows older): informal "adults understand the idea of saving electricity, but are subject to occasional senior moments of forgetfulness"

A senior momentis a nonmedical term for a brief lapse of memory or a moment of confusion. While these are more common in older adults, senior moments can happen to anyone, at any age. senior moment. noun. /ˌsiːniə ˈməʊmənt/. /ˌsiːniər ˈməʊmənt/. (humorous) an occasion when somebody forgets something, or does not think clearly (thought to be typical of what happens when people get older) It was an important meeting and a bad time to have a senior moment. Topics Life stages c2.
